Together we break through as Senior Bench Scientist I / II  (all genders)(full-time fixed-term)

The Senior Scientist is an accomplished neuroscientist who will make substantial contributions to the conception and execution of new therapeutic approaches for neurodegenerative and psychiatric diseases in a collaborative environment. This role is a fixed term position until November 2027.

 

Make your mark:

  • Conceive plan coordinate & conduct pharmacological in vivo studies in animal models for Alzheimers and Parkinsons Disease as well as psychiatric diseases including histological biochemical and molecular biological endpoints while establishing and validating novel animal models for these diseases.
  • Practice in vivo techniques in rodents including microsurgeries dosing via different routes sampling of CSF and blood perfusions dissection of brain regions and related tasks.
  • Set up optimize and validate histological protein biochemistry and molecular biology assays e.g. ligand binding assays quantitative PCR (qPCR). Experience with mass spectrometry would be advantageous.
  • Highly autonomous and productive in performing research or method development to address key scientific questions.
  • Independently interpret scientific data and initiate next steps as well as provide mentorship and guidance to others.
  • Present scientific plans and data internally to project teams and scientific communities.
  • Routinely demonstrate scientific initiative and creativity that advances research projects or technologies and lead those efforts.
  • Develop and maintain productive collaborations with other groups across science disciplines and global colleagues including planning and coordination of complex experiments.

 


Qualifications :

This is how you make a difference:

  • PhD in Neuroscience pharmacology biochemistry biology or related field in neurodegenerative and/or psychiatric diseases with a strong focus on animal models.
  • Strong expertise in effectively working with rodents (must possess proof of competence in laboratory animal science such as FELASA B certificate or equivalent).
  • A high degree of self-initiative flexibility and curiosity as well as excellent teamwork and interpersonal relationship skills.
  • Excellent skills in planning and coordinating complex interdisciplinary studies.
  • Very good communication skills and proficiency in English written and oral (basic knowledge in German advantageous)
  • Openness to work on weekends when necessary.
